PhilHealth president resigns

Sheila Crisostomo - The Philippine Star

MANILA, Philippines - Philippine Health Insurance Corp. (PhilHealth) interim president and chief executive officer (PCEO) Hildegardes Dineros yesterday resigned from his post, according to Health Secretary Paulyn Ubial, amid a power struggle between the two officials.

An appointee of President Duterte, Dineros quit after Ubial questioned his appointment of some people as “illegal.”

Ubial did not elaborate but said in an interview that Dineros had “acted beyond his authority.”

The rift between Ubial and Dineros started when Dineros re-assigned and re-appointed personnel, although his appointment in an interim capacity did not give him the power to do so.

A PhilHealth advisory showed that Dineros, a bariatic and metabolic surgeon, had submitted his resignation and it was accepted yesterday by the PhilHealth board in a special meeting.

“He realized he was misled and was wrong, so he resigned. We elected Dr. Celestina dela Serna, one of the board members (of PhilHealth) as interim PCEO in his place,” Ubial said.

Dela Serna, who used to be director for Filipino migrant workers sector, shall serve as “interim/OIC PCEO of PhilHealth pending nomination to be made by the President of the Philippines and subsequent election by the board of a regular PCEO.”
